libtoolize and AC_CONFIG_SUBDIRS: msg#00146sysutils.autoconf.general
Some issues related to use of CVS libtool with AC_CONFIG_SUBDIRS: 1. libtoolize doesn't appear to recurse into AC_CONFIG_SUBDIRS. Should it? Or is this autoreconf's job? 2. I cannot get CVS autoreconf to work at all with CVS libtool. Perhaps this is a Known Issue; but I haven't seen it mentioned. 3. If I execute libtoolize in the subpackage root directory, it seems to "know" that AC_CONFIG_AUX_DIR should be "..". I don't explicitly use the AC_CONFIG_AUX_DIR macro anywhere, so I'm guessing libtoolize does some sniffing. Perhaps it should do something similar for AC_CONFIG_MACRO_DIR? (That is, use the main package's AC_CONFIG_MACRO_DIR if none is set in the subpackage's configure.ac.) Braden |
